You have been subscribed to a public bug: This morning, the following packages upgraded. Since doing so (and restarting, but not sure how related that is), keyboard input in gnome applications periodically freezes, while I can still input to xterms, use the mouse to switch focus, etc The typed keys eventualy show up in the applications they're typed into, but the specific application being typed into completely freezes
